Microsoft Driver Tetherxp.inf Windows 10 -

tetherxp.inf is a legacy configuration file originally designed by Google and Microsoft to enable USB tethering for Android devices on Windows XP Microsoft Learn Windows 10 , you generally do need this file because the operating system includes modern Remote NDIS (RNDIS) drivers natively that automatically recognize Android tethering. DroidForums.net tetherxp.inf on Windows 10?

The only reason to use this file on a modern system like Windows 10 is if your specific Android device is not being recognized as a network adapter when you toggle "USB Tethering" on. In such cases, the

file acts as a "map" to tell Windows which built-in driver to use for your phone's specific Hardware ID. Fairphone Community Forum How to Install (If Required)

The tetherxp.inf file is a legacy configuration file originally designed by Microsoft to enable USB tethering on Windows XP systems. While it was essential for older OS versions to recognize Android phones as Remote NDIS (RNDIS) networking devices, Windows 10 generally does not require this file because it includes native support for RNDIS drivers. 1. Purpose and Function

Driver Bridge: It instructs Windows XP to use built-in RNDIS drivers (usb8023m.sys and rndismpm.sys) for tethering, which the OS doesn't automatically associate with Android hardware.

Hardware Identification: The file contains "Hardware IDs" (Vendor ID and Product ID) that match specific phone models to the system's network drivers.

Legacy Context: Modern Windows versions (7, 8, 10, and 11) have updated RNDIS implementations that automatically detect most tethered devices without manual INF files. 2. Windows 10 Compatibility

In most cases, you should not need to install tetherxp.inf on Windows 10. If a device is not recognized, it is often due to driver signing requirements or the need for a more modern "Universal INF".

The file tetherxp.inf is a legacy driver configuration file originally created for Windows XP to enable Android USB tethering, and it is entirely unnecessary for Windows 10. Windows 10 has native, built-in support for Remote NDIS (RNDIS) devices and does not require this file to share your smartphone's internet connection. 📄 Overview of tetherxp.inf

Purpose: It tells legacy Windows operating systems how to use their own built-in network drivers (usb8023m.sys and rndismpm.sys) to communicate with an Android device acting as a USB modem. microsoft driver tetherxp.inf windows 10

Origin: It was historically provided by Google or phone manufacturers as a lightweight setup file specifically for Windows XP.

How it worked: It matched the unique Hardware ID (Vendor ID and Product ID) of a phone to the generic Windows Remote NDIS driver. 💻 Windows 10 Compatibility & Usage

You should not attempt to force-install tetherxp.inf on Windows 10. Doing so can cause system instability or driver conflicts because:

Native Support: Windows 10 automatically detects Android phones in USB tethering mode and loads the modern, integrated RNDIS driver by default.

Architecture Differences: The file points to legacy NDIS 5.1 driver structures meant for 32-bit Windows XP, which are incompatible with the advanced driver architecture of Windows 10. 🛠️ How to USB Tether on Windows 10 Properly

If you are trying to share your phone's internet connection with a Windows 10 computer, no external files are required. Follow these steps:

Connect your Android smartphone to your Windows 10 PC using a high-quality USB cable.

Open your phone's settings and navigate to Network & Internet (or Connections). Select the Hotspot & Tethering sub-menu. Toggle on the USB Tethering switch.

Wait a few seconds as Windows 10 will automatically install the correct network adapter. Troubleshooting on Windows 10 tetherxp

If your computer fails to recognize the tethered phone, the issue is usually a corrupted driver or a bad cable, not a missing .inf file:

Try a different USB cable or port to rule out physical hardware issues.

Update the driver manually through the Windows Device Manager: Right-click the Start Button and select Device Manager. Expand the Network adapters list.

Look for a device with a yellow exclamation mark or named something similar to "Remote NDIS based Internet Sharing Device".

Right-click it, choose Update driver, and select Search automatically for drivers.

Are you trying to resolve a specific error code on your Windows 10 computer while tethering? configuration file tetherxp.inf - Microsoft Q&A

Anonymous. Apr 17, 2013, 1:17 PM. where do i find a configuration file called tetherxp.inf that i can download. Windows for home | Microsoft Learn tetherxp/tetherxp.inf at master · imrehg/tetherxp - GitHub

The tetherxp.inf file is a legacy configuration file primarily used to enable USB tethering on Windows XP systems. It is not a standard driver for Windows 10, as modern Windows versions (Windows 7 and later) have built-in support for Remote NDIS (RNDIS) devices used in mobile tethering. Key Takeaways & Usage

Purpose: It instructs Windows XP on how to use the RNDIS drivers already present in the operating system to recognize an Android phone as a network adapter. Step 5: Re-enable Security (Optional but Recommended) To

Windows 10 Compatibility: While users sometimes search for it for Windows 10, it is largely obsolete for this OS. Windows 10 typically handles USB tethering automatically once enabled on the mobile device.

When it is used on Windows 10: Some users attempt to use modified versions of this INF file on Windows 10 if their specific hardware is not being recognized by the default RNDIS driver. However, Microsoft does not officially support modifying these driver files for Windows 10, as it can lead to device instability. Common Issues & Troubleshooting

Code 10 Error: On older systems like Windows XP SP2, the file may fail if the system lacks updated RNDIS drivers, resulting in a "This device cannot start (Code 10)" error.

Missing Device IDs: If your specific phone is not recognized, users often have to manually edit the .inf file to add their device's specific Hardware ID (VID/PID).

Installation on Windows 10: If you must install a driver via an INF on Windows 10, you can do so by right-clicking the file in File Explorer and selecting Install, or by using Device Manager to manually "Browse my computer" and "Let me pick from a list". configuration file tetherxp.inf - Microsoft Q&A

Apr 17, 2556 BE — Anonymous. Apr 17, 2013, 1:17 PM. where do i find a configuration file called tetherxp.inf that i can download. Windows for home | Microsoft Learn Windows XP SP2 (and lower) problem with USB tethering


Step 5: Re-enable Security (Optional but Recommended)

To turn signature enforcement back on:

  1. Open Command Prompt as Administrator.
  2. Type: bcdedit.exe /set nointegritychecks off
  3. Press Enter.

8. Legacy and Lessons

tetherxp.inf became a cult symbol of Microsoft's backward compatibility burden. Its story teaches:

If you encounter a reference to tetherxp.inf on Windows 10 today, it's either:

  1. A leftover file from an old installation (harmless, inactive).
  2. Part of a third-party USB tethering tool that still attempts to load it.
  3. A nostalgic artifact in driver backup folders.

Final verdict: Dead but not buried on Windows 10—buried completely on Windows 11. Use Wi-Fi hotspot or rndismp6.inf.

4. Security Considerations: Is tetherxp.inf a Malware Vector?

Because tetherxp.inf is a legitimate Microsoft file, malware authors sometimes disguise their drivers with the same name. Be cautious of:

For Generic RNDIS Devices